Amendments to Part 3 of Schedule 2

4.—(1) Part 3 (changes of use) of Schedule 2 is amended as follows.

(2) For Class A (restaurants, cafes or takeaways to retail), substitute—

Class A – casino, betting office, pay day loan shop or hot food takeaway to commercial, business and service

Permitted development

A. Development consisting of a change of use of a building from a use falling within one of the following provisions of the Use Classes Order—

(a)article 3(6)(m) (casino);

(b)article 3(6)(n) (betting office);

(c)article 3(6)(o) (pay day loan shop); or

(d)article 3(6)(r) (hot food takeaway),

to a use falling within Class E (commercial, business and service) of Schedule 2 to that Order.

Conditions

A.1.  Development under Class A is permitted subject to the condition that, before beginning the development, the developer provides written notification to the local planning authority of the date on which the use of the building will change..

(11) For Class I (industrial and general business conversions), substitute—

Class I – industrial conversions

Permitted development

I. Development consisting of a change of use of a building from any use falling within Class B2 (general industrial) of Schedule 1 to the Use Classes Order, to a use for any purpose falling within Class B8 (storage or distribution) of that Schedule.

Development not permitted

I.1.  Development is not permitted by Class I if the change of use relates to more than 500 square metres of floor space in the building..

(b)after paragraph MA.2, insert—

Interpretation of Class MA

MA.3. Development meets the fire risk condition referred to in paragraph MA.2(2)(i) if the development relates to a building which will—

(a)contain two or more dwellinghouses; and

(b)satisfy the height condition in paragraph (3), read with paragraph (7), of article 9A (fire statements) of the Town and Country Planning (Development Management Procedure) (England) Order 2015(3)..

(17) In Class R (agricultural buildings to a flexible commercial use)—

(a)for paragraph R (permitted development), substitute—

Permitted development

R. Development consisting of a change of use of a building and any land within its curtilage from a use as an agricultural building to a flexible use falling within one of the following provisions of the Use Classes Order—

(a)Class B8 (storage or distribution) of Schedule 1;

(b)Class C1 (hotels) of Schedule 1; or

(c)Class E (commercial, business or service) of Schedule 2.;

(b)in sub-paragraph (c) of paragraph R.2 (conditions), for “Class G” substitute “Class E”.
